自动登录时自动解锁密钥环,无需保留未加密的密码

自动登录时自动解锁密钥环,无需保留未加密的密码

因此,当我自动登录 Ubuntu 时,我总是弹出解锁密钥环的窗口。这里有一个解决方法:如何才能不再提示我在启动时解锁“默认”密钥环?

我已经在 Google 上搜索了大约一个小时,而这个问题的解决方案似乎总是一样的:通过将密码留空或关闭自动登录来完全忽略安全性。

我真的很想找到一种方法来使用自动登录功能并避免看到这个弹出窗口无需保留未加密的密码

是否有可能在上游修复此错误,以便用户不必与此自动登录失败弹出窗口作斗争?

先感谢您!

答案1

无法启用密钥环密码、使用自动登录和禁用弹出窗口。这是设计使然。

密码应以某种方式输入。如果启用自动登录,则无需输入密码。

如果任何人都无需输入任何密码即可启动系统,那么启用密钥环密码的原因是什么?

你的建议毫无意义。而且这不是一个错误。因此它不会被修复。

答案2

虽然您的问题非常合理,但您问的却是一件根本不可能的事情。

您需要密钥来加密和解密某些内容。当您使用登录名时,登录密码将用作加密和解密密钥环的密钥。当您不使用登录名时,没有任何东西可以加密密钥环。唯一的选择是操作系统将密钥存储在您的计算机上。锁上保险箱并将钥匙留在钥匙孔中是没有用的。 如果您的计算机加密密钥环并存储密码,它就会这样做。

答案3

  1. 转到 Ubuntu 应用程序 > “密码和密钥环”
  2. 右键点击“登录”>“更改密码”
  3. 使用相同的旧密码。

这里是来源Unity 上有图片,Gnome 没什么不同,流程相同

答案4

每当我点击 Chrome 浏览器时,我都会弹出这些“默认密钥环”窗口。当您更改系统/用户密码时,就会发生这种情况。这个解决方案对我来说很有效,所以如果这对您有帮助,请告诉我。只需按照下面给出的步骤操作即可。

转到文件 > “按 Ctrl+H” > .local > 共享 > 密钥环。

keyrings 文件夹中将有 2 个文件。只需删除“login.keyring”,然后重新启动系统即可。当您输入用户 ID 和密码时,您的 keyrings 密码也将自动更新,弹出窗口也将停止。不必担心删除“login.keyring”文件,因为当您登录系统时它将自动再次生成。

相关内容